Micron Solutions is a multifaceted contract manufacturing organization specializing in thermoplastic injection molding, precision machining and finishing, and silver-plated medical sensors for disposable electrodes. We collaborate with clients of all sizes to provide manufacturing solutions and assembly services that support their goals from concept to commercialization. Our 120,000 square foot Fitchburg, MA facility is equipped to manage projects across the full product lifecycle.
The Maintenance Technician 2 conducts all repair and preventive maintenance activities associated with the injection-molding and CNC Equipment as directed by the Maintenance Engineer. Maintenance Technician 2 will provide support and training to Maintenance Technician 1 to develop the skills and abilities of the Maintenance Technician 1.

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ES
- Ensure compliance with all molding‑area procedures and policies
- Perform preventative maintenance on all molding presses, CNC machines, and accessory equipment, and escalate issues to the Maintenance Engineer
- Manage daily maintenance activities for molding and CNC equipment
- Perform hands‑on repair, installation, and upkeep of all equipment in the molding and machining departments
- Strive for efficient use of materials and personnel
- Understand and follow quality management system procedures related to ISO 13485
- Follow Work Instructions and complete all related data‑collection documents
- Provide technical support to the Molding, Machining, and Tool Room departments
- Work safely and follow all safety regulations to prevent injuries
- Support and train Maintenance Technician I to develop their skills and abilities
- Adhere to all company policies
- Perform other duties as assigned
- High school diploma or GED preferred
- Ability to read and comprehend written work instructions
- Ability to understand verbal instructions
- Basic computer skills for entering daily information
- Proficient in the proper and safe use of hand tools
- Physically capable of safely lifting up to 50 pounds
- 2–3 years of experience performing service work on injection molding equipment and/or CNC milling equipment.
